Session description
Subduction zones drive plate tectonics, regulate long-term climate through deep volatile cycling. Southwest Pacific is the ideal laboratory to study the full-spectrum of the subduction processes (subduction initiation, intermediate-deep earthquake, plume-slab interaction, polarity reversal, eclogite exhumation) in a complex plate boundary zone. Recent deployment of broadband OBS in the Tonga-Samoa region and Matthew-Hunter zone will provide new seismic imaging (surface and body waves models, seismic anisotropy patterns) of these regions. The development of OBS seismic phase pickers provides a unique opportunity to revise earthquake catalogs and slab geometries. New numerical simulations framework gives an opportunity to revise our knowledge on subduction processes. This session aims to discuss the SW Pacific subduction zones from a multi-disciplinary approach (geophysics, geochemistry, geomorphology, numerical modelling) to attempts to reconcile observations from different fields. We invite contributions from colleagues working on Papua New Guinea, Matthew-Hunter zone, Vanuatu, Tonga-Samoa-Lau basin, Kermadec subduction zone or Puysegur trench.
